Navigating the Challenges of IT Security in the Remote Work Era

The shift to remote work has transformed the IT landscape, presenting both opportunities and challenges for security professionals. In this article, we will explore the key IT security challenges faced by remote teams and provide actionable strategies to mitigate risks.

1. Increased Vulnerability to Cyber Attacks

Remote work environments often lack the robust security measures found in traditional office settings. With employees accessing corporate data from various locations, the vulnerability to cyber attacks has increased significantly.

2. Phishing Scams on the Rise

Cybercriminals are leveraging the remote work trend by launching sophisticated phishing attacks. Training employees to recognize and report suspicious emails is crucial in preventing data breaches.

3. The Importance of Secure VPNs

Virtual Private Networks (VPNs) have become essential for ensuring secure connections. Organizations must provide employees with reliable VPN solutions to protect sensitive data during remote access.

4.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A) Implementation

MFA adds an extra layer of security for remote workers. By requiring multiple forms of verification, organizations can significantly reduce the risk of unauthorized access to their systems.

5. Regular Security Audits and Training

Conducting regular security audits and training sessions can help organizations stay ahead of potential threats. Continuous education ensures that employees are aware of the latest security measures and best practices.

Conclusion

As remote work continues to be the norm, organizations must adapt their IT security strategies to meet new challenges. By implementing these strategies, businesses can maintain a secure digital environment and protect their sensitive data.
